Gov. Jay Inslee’s statement on today’s Open Internet decision by the FCC
February 26, 2015
Story "I applaud today's decisive Open Internet decision by Chairman Wheeler and the Federal Communications Commission. The internet is far and away the greatest economic, social and civic tool of the modern age and by their vote, the FCC has recognized that all Americans must continue to get open and equitable treatment, free of discrimination. This is a big win for Washingtonians who create, innovate or communicate on the internet."
